If you delete a label in Gmail, the emails within that label will be moved to the “All Mail” tab.

Go to Gmail Settings > Labels.Select the labels you want to delete.Click Delete Label under Actions.

No. The Gmail labels are not the same as folders in Outlook or other email clients. The labels function as filters for the inbox and as such, they don’t delete any emails.
